
TitleMax
CLOSED NOW
Today: 10:00 am - 7:00 pm
Tomorrow: 10:00 am - 7:00 pm
TitleBucks Title Loans
https://www.titlebucks.com/store/south-houston-tx-title-loans
Phone: (713) 360-5091
Address: 2 Spencer Hwy, South Houston, TX 77587
Website: https://www.titlebucks.com/store/south-houston-tx-title-loans